Your account has successfully been deleted. We're sorry to see you go!

All Tech jobs

11,441 - 11,460 of 62,670 positions


relevance | date

  • Newark, NJ NJ 07102 Newark, NJ
  • 2 hours ago 2026-01-20T12:45:35Z
Are these results helpful to you? Yes | No